#427441 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#427441 is composed of 25.9% red, 45.5%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 44%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 118.8 degrees, a saturation of 28.2% and a lightness of 35.5%. #427441 color hex could be obtained by blending #84e882 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#427441 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#427441 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#427441 has RGB values of R:66, G:116,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4355137.

Shades and Tints of #427441
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020302 is the darkest color, while #f5faf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#427441
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565f56 is the less saturated color, while #06b302 is the most saturated one.
